在软件开发中,我们经常会面临一个重要的问题:选择最小版本。这个问题可能看起来简单,但实际上却是一个需要慎重考虑的抉择。在2024年,我们再次审视这个问题,希望能够为大家带来一些新的启示。
最小版本选择并不仅仅是为了解决依赖关系的问题,它还关乎到软件的稳定性、可维护性以及未来的发展。在选择最小版本时,我们要考虑多方面的因素,包括不同版本之间的兼容性、性能表现以及安全性等等。
在过去的几年里,我们可能会因为升级到最新版本而遇到一些困难和挑战。有时候新版本会引入一些不兼容的改动,导致我们的应用出现bug或者性能下降。因此,在选择最小版本时,我们需要权衡新特性和稳定性之间的关系,确保我们的应用能够继续稳定运行。
此外,随着软件开发的不断发展,我们可能会面临更多复杂的版本选择问题。比如,如果我们的应用依赖于多个库,每个库又有不同的版本,那么我们要如何来选择最小版本呢?这就需要我们更加深入地理解每个库的特性和依赖关系,以便做出更加明智的选择。
总的来说,最小版本选择是一个需要谨慎思考的问题。我们需要根据实际情况来选择最适合我们应用的版本,确保我们的软件能够在未来持续发展。希望通过这次审视,能够为大家在选择最小版本时提供一些新的思路和启示。
了解更多有趣的事情:https://blog.ds3783.com/